Bangladesh's Taijul Islam Enters Elite Test Club After Breaking Starc's Record
Bangladesh spinner Taijul Islam achieved a special personal milestone despite his team’s hefty defeat in the one-off Test match against Zimbabwe. Left-arm spinner registered 7 for 138 in the opposition’s first innings in Harare Sports Club and this also became his 19th five-wicket haul in the format. The left-arm spinner's haul of 7 wickets came off 40.2 overs which put him amongst the leading left-arm bowlers in Test history.
His efforts though impressive, weren't enough to prevent the hosts from achieving a historic innings and 85 run victory.
With this latest haul Taijul also drew level with former Bangladesh skipper Shakib Al Hasan
Shakib required 121 innings to reach the 19 five-fors while Starc needed 202 innings to bag his 18 five-fors.
